Hindu Persection of Christians in India

Written By: Elwood McQuaid  |  Posted: Tuesday, April 13th, 2010

Compass Direct News reports that Christians in India were battered last year by radical Hindu extremists. A partial listing of the violent attacks confirmed that Christians were assaulted more than three times each week. As in many areas dominated by radical Muslims, Hindu militants employ the spurious accusation of "forcible conversions" against believers marked for attacks. The situation boils down to the question, "Who will the courts believe?" Most often they side against Christians falsely accused of forcing people to convert to Christianity.

Dr. John Dayal, a member of the government's National Integration Council, said, "If 2007 and 2008 went down in history as the most blood-soaked ones in history of modern Christianity in India, 2009 surely rates as the year of frustrating confrontations with the law and tardy governance and on justice for the victims of communal violence."
